It worked as a should I was able to tap it in the broken fitting and then put a half inch ratchet wrench on the back I was able to back out the broken fitting. The hardest part was removing the broken fitting from the easy out after I finished.

These aren't American made. That's fairly evident if you've been around hand tools long enough. Which isn't to say they are bad, but they are knockoffs of much more expensive ones. If you want to use a socket wrench or butterfly to chase tapped holes, these work fine. I'd be leery about using an impact on them for serious amounts of time. I think they spring would be the potential failure point. But, from a tool maker perspective, these are a good value. It's definitely a setup up from my homemade version where I plug welded a hand tap handle into a socket!
